Дмитрий
и в матерала разюиваешь на макеты отдельные
Дмитрий
получаешь от плагина что вызывается, и подгружаешь шаблон
Иван
😉 пасиб)
Иван
но в ядро они такое не хотят тащить да?) или никто не интересовался?))
Дмитрий
вс очень просто и элегантно делается
Дмитрий
только если что учитывай еще get параметры
Дмитрий
их выкинуть надо если что
Дмитрий
проверь их
Иван
ага
Дмитрий
я просто это еще не дописал этот кусок
Дмитрий
из адреса выкинь для разбора все параметры
Дмитрий
но потом джумле их верни обязательно
Дмитрий
тебе просто вырезать свое надо
Дмитрий
если оно есть
Дмитрий
я на этом механизме и построил мультисайтинг
Иван
Джумла,отдай кусок я тебе говорю
Дмитрий
на таком обмане джумлы
Дмитрий
чтобы были адреса в sitemap.xml
Дмитрий
Дмитрий
я с игорем согласен
Дмитрий
если тее нужно, то пишется компонент
Дмитрий
или переопределение роутинга нормальное
Дмитрий
здесь есть элеганттный простой выход в данном случае
Дмитрий
Дмитрий
я это имел ввиду
Дмитрий
плагины могут вносить правки в роутинг компонента
Igor
Я кстати sef фильтр на Атоме тоже через плагин буду делать, а не дописывать роутинг.
Так проще =)
Дмитрий
а на фильтрах материалов есть чпу?
Дмитрий
там просто я видел
Дмитрий
просто чпу можно построить по такому же прицнипу
Дмитрий
Igor
Но думаю что принцип тот же в любом случае
Дмитрий
/katalog/nogti/proizvoditeli__arnelle/strana__germaniya
Дмитрий
я вот такого добился
Дмитрий
в адресах
Дмитрий
Дмитрий
тут просто работает комбинаторика
Дмитрий
и им надо задать порядок
Igor
Не думал на этим пока еще.
Дмитрий
то етсь у тебя зафиксирвоанные поля?
Igor
Дмитрий
просто когда неизвестно сколько и сколько значений тут главное не уйти каждый с каждым вообще
Дмитрий
там факториал получаетя
Дмитрий
им надо задать порядок верный
Дмитрий
и не смешивать
Дмитрий
тогда другая формула работает
Igor
Ну в общем, я пока еще не думал какой будет урл.
Ибо sef фильтрация пойдет отдельной версией.
Vladimir
Вышла Joomla! 4 Beta 2
Мы на чуточку стали ближе к выходу стабильного релиза Joomla 4. Сегодня свет увидел релиз Beta 2.
В чем разница между Beta 1 и Beta 2? Joomla 4 Beta 2 содержит более 200 исправлений ошибок из Beta 1. В том числе добавлено обратно несовместимое изменение в пакет Filter, чтобы удалить терминологию черного и белого списков (blacklist / whitelist).
Внимание! Не используйте бета версии на живых сайтах. Они предназначены исключительно для тестирования.
https://joomlaportal.ru/news/release-news/3090-vyshla-joomla-4-beta-2
Vladimir
блять
Vladimir
серьезно?
Vladimir
чёрный и белый список добрался до джумла?
Igor
Igor
Ну а если честно, в концепии Filter я бы использовал более логичные.
Allowed и Not Allowed
Vladimir
https://habr.com/ru/company/ruvds/blog/508708/
Vladimir
какая хорошая статья
Dmitry
Как сделать так, чтобы ваш код оставался простым и поддерживаемым
Разрабатывая новое приложение, вы начинаете с маленькой и простой кодовой базы. Но со временем код растет и становится все более сложным. Бороться с возрастающей сложностью тяжело — так же, как и следить за тем, чтобы кодовая база оставалась поддерживаемой в долгосрочной перспективе. Представляем несколько принципов, которые помогут справляться с этими проблемами.
Читать статью
Igor
Vladimir
Учитывайте стоимость поддержки кода, а не только стоимость разработки
Vladimir
важное замечание - я всегда его всем напоминаю
Vladimir
и это кстати причина выбора Joomla
Vladimir
отсутствие нормальной архитектуры
Vladimir
ты и так знаешь
Den 💙💛
И при этом он занял все ниши
Vladimir
я хочу повторить :)
Vladimir
точнее хочу чтобы повторили мы, а не я
Den 💙💛
Возглавь осм
Den 💙💛
Выдвигаем кандидату и голосуем
Vladimir
ну или черный
Vladimir
Масштабная кампания по взлому сайтов на WordPress
В начале июня специалистами Wordfence была зафиксирована вторая волна хакерских атак на сайты на WordPress. Первая была в мае. Поскольку атаки были организованы с IP-адресов, часть которых использовалась хакерами ранее, эксперты Wordfence считают, что обе кампании по взлому — дело рук одной и той же группы злоумышленников.
В этот раз взломщики использовали старые уязвимости в плагинах и попытались скачать с сайтов файлы конфигурации. По оценкам экспертов, это составило около 75% всех попыток использования уязвимостей в плагинах и темах для WordPress.